New Zealand Association for Training and Development Networking Lunch

Meeting members from the New Zealand Association for Training and Development (NZATD) was a great chance for us to build new relationships and learn from some remarkable professionals involved in L&D across a variety of industries.


Some of the key topics we discussed:

  • The absolute importance of the learner being at the heart of all we do.
  • Industry-relevance is a must (not a nice add-on).
  • How a negative experience with training (online or otherwise) can make an organisation reluctant to engage in that form of learning again.

Project Management Institute of New Zealand 2025 Conference

Our team were excited to sponsor an exhibit table at the recent Project Management Institute of New Zealand conference at the Aotea Centre in Auckland. Over 200 project management professionals, often leaders in their organisations and sectors, spent time letting us know about their experiences, opportunities, and challenges that exist in upskilling their teams. Luckily we had a lot to offer them!

From our two short courses for working professionals through to the upcoming Master's in Project Management (subject to CUAP and TEC approval) we can offer something for everyone. From those at the very beginning of their project management careers or working in adjacent roles but keen to learn more, all the way through to experienced and qualified leaders in the field who want to continue to upskill in the most flexible and industry-relevant way.

Key insights we gained:

  • Even with a successful PMO in place, many large organisations are recognising a few crucial gaps that may require an external provider to fill. 
  • Upskilling teams at scale is a tricky thing to master (imagine if you could offer a short course online to upskill large numbers over a short period of time! 😉).
  • Flexible and accessible training is top of the list – upskilling while working is the most cost-effective and efficient option.
  • A post-graduate qualification is very appealing to many leaders in the field.
